$S&P/ASX 200(.XJO.AU)$ closed 1.2% lower at 7588.2, pulling back from the previous session's record close following comments by Fed Chair Jerome Powell that a March interest-rate cut looks unlikely.

$S&P/ASX 200(.XJO.AU)$ closed 1.65% higher at 7377.9 on broad-based gains. The benchmark index jumped at the open after U.S. Federal Reserve officials penciled in three rate cuts for 2024 and held onto its gains through the session.
